Maye it's just me, but when I was with Red Cross Volunteer First Aid Corps in DC, we provided EMS coverage for every major ( & many minor) events, particularly downtown. For events like big parades & demonstrations and the Fourth of July, the USPP had their command vehicle &/or a trailer for command & ops (usually on the Monument grounds) and they always had room for one or two of us to help expedite EMS services dispatches. These were near the front, next to their dispatchers, not in the back! Maybe they really liked us....or just wanted us near the door in case they decided to throw us out!

You have to consider who is more important, cops who ENFORCE LAWS or the
folks who try to coordinate saving lives and helping people through
disasters. Unfortunately, the shooters tend to get the lion's share because
they have the guns and the other guys don't.
FWIW I am not a cop hater. I just understand the reality of how things work.
I was in Arlington when they got their command bus in 1989/90. The cops took
over almost the entire bus including the driver's seat. IIRC, the AFD and
Arlington Co's EMA got a chair to share in the back next to the fax machine.
The cops setting it up thought it was very funny.
